Why did the U.S. become involved in Afghanistan?

Respuesta :

emmagboutwell emmagboutwell
  • 17-04-2020

Answer:

Its public aims were to dismantle al-Qaeda and deny it a safe base of operations in Afghanistan by removing the Taliban from power.
